So much has been happening in Toronto this week. As encampments are cleared, the mayor and the federal government are c613-5641-accd-2b6fc8ec5c3b.html"> fighting over shelter and 621b-52c8-a0a3-53fa0fc41a9e.html"> housing dollars and the city is cancelling plans for public washrooms even as it opens all of its ice rinks. Joined by Shawn Micallef, Matt Elliott issues his first look at how Mayor Olivia Chow’s council support has lined up in her first months (and the dynamic duo of consistent oppositions to her). Plus, a little sliver of good news for GTA transit riders.
